List Of TVET Colleges In Johannesburg Offering NSFAS

find a sample of the courses these tvet colleges offer below;

  • Ekurhuleni West TVET College:

Ekurhuleni West TVET College is a top TVET college in the Johannesburg region. A variety of programmes in subjects like engineering, business studies, and information technology are available at the college, which is dedicated to providing high-quality instruction and training. For more information about the college’s application processes and available courses, prospective students can visit the official website or get in touch with the admissions office.

  • South West Gauteng TVET College:

Located in the centre of Johannesburg, South West Gauteng TVET College is well-known for offering a wide variety of programmes that meet the needs of different businesses. This college offers chances for skill development regardless of your interests—hotel, engineering, or the arts. For the most recent information on programme offers, admission requirements, and application procedures, visit their official website.

  • Johannesburg Central TVET College:

Johannesburg Central TVET College is a shining example of education, providing courses that are tailored to the needs of the contemporary workforce. Students with aspirations can look into courses in engineering, health sciences, and business studies. Go to the college’s website to begin the application process, or contact the admissions office for detailed instructions.

  • Sedibeng TVET College:

Located in the southern part of Gauteng, Sedibeng TVET College is committed to empowering individuals through education and training. The college provides a diverse range of programs, including those in agriculture, tourism, and public management. To apply, interested candidates can access the application forms and guidelines on the college’s official website.

TVET Colleges In Johannesburg NSFAS Qualification Criteria

The only people eligible for this scholarship project are South African citizens.

  • A student must be enrolled in a PLP, NC(V), or Report 191 programme or intending to enrol at one of South Africa’s fifty (50) public TVET colleges;
  • must need financial aid (a student’s eligibility for financial aid is determined by the NSFAS);
  • Returning students must demonstrate documented and acknowledged academic performance (academically meritorious) following the College’s advancement programme or the Bursary Rules and Guidelines, whichever is greater;
  • The applicant must not be enrolling for a qualification that replicates prior state-funded learning; additionally, the applicant may be eligible if their combined gross family income does not exceed R350,000 annually and they have been accepted into or received a solid offer of enrollment from a college.

Who Should Apply For  NSFAS Funding In Johannesburg

  • All South African citizens
  • All SASSA grant recipients qualify for funding
  • Applicants whose combined household income is not more than R350 000 per annum
  • The person with a disability: Combined household income must not be more than R600 000 per annum
  • Students who started studying before 2018 and whose household income is not more than R122 000 per annum.
